Description

Black and white view of the ruins of a Roman bridge in Constantine, with stone arches and vegetation overgrowing the remains. The reverse features a handwritten address to Mademoiselle Noblet in Orléans, an Algerian postmark from 1905, and a cancellation stamp from Constantine dated August 22, 1905.
